해당 매크로는 TokenMod라는 API를 사용합니다. API를 사용하기 위해서는 GM이 Pro계정을 사용하고 있어야합니다.


+API는 방을 복사할 때 같이 복사가 안 되므로 방을 복사하신 경우 반드시 API를 다시 추가해주시고 권한 명령어도 다시 입력해주세요.
다행히도 토큰 id는 그대로 복사되므로 다른 부분은 건드릴 필요가 없습니다.


1.API설치

API의 설치방법에 대해서는 이 게시글(배경음/효과음매크로)을 참고해주세요.
(게시글 내용대로 AudioMaster를 설치하지 마시고 TokenMod를 설치해주세요>.ㅇ)

이 API는 이 게시글(마소차지용 토큰 배포글)에서도 사용하고 있습니다. 참고 삼아 읽어보셔도 좋습니다.


2. Rollable Table로 배경용 다면 토큰 만들기

설치하고 난 이후에는 Rollable table에 배경이미지를 등록해줍시다.



이름은 일일히 등록해 줄 필요가 없습니다. 순서만 잘 기억해두시면 됩니다.

배경 이미지는 무료배포 배경을 사용했습니다. 

원하는 배경을 다 등록해두었다면 Rollable table의 토큰 버튼을 눌러서 맵에 배경용 토큰을 생성해줍시다.

토큰의 id를 추출할 때는 이 토큰의 id만 추출해주시면 됩니다.


3. 매크로 만들기

그럼 매크로를 작성해봅시다.



아까 Rollable table에 작성해둔 순서대로 숫자를 넣습니다. 

위에서 이름을 일일히 등록할 필요가 없는 이유는 이미지의 순서만 있으면 되기 때문입니다.


여기서 사용할 수 있는 매크로는 크게 2가지가 있습니다. 


3-1. 토큰을 선택한 상태로 배경 변경 시키기

토큰을 선택한 상태로 배경이미지를 변경하게 하고 싶다면 다음과 같이 작성합니다. 

이 경우 해당 토큰의 권한을 플레이어에게 주는 것을 잊지마세요. 


!token-mod --set currentside|?{어디로?|배경1,1|배경2,2}

위와 같이 입력해두면 세팅은 끝입니다.

3-2. 토큰을 선택하지 않은 상태로 배경 변경 시키기

이 방법은 세팅이 조금 번거롭습니다.


토큰을 선택하지않은 상태로도 배경이미지를 변경하게 하고 싶다면 다음과 같이 작성합니다. 

이 경우 해당 토큰의 권한을 플레이어에게 주지않아도 됩니다.

!token-mod --ids token의 ID --set currentside|?{어디로?|배경1,1|배경2,2}


단, 이 매크로는 토큰의 아이디를 입력해주어야 합니다.

그럼 토큰의 아이디를 확인하기 위해 다음의 명령어를 채팅창에 입력해주세요.

@{target|token_id}


그러면 화면의 위쪽에 다음과 같은 안내메세지가 뜹니다. 그럼 맵 위에서 원하는 토큰(배경용)을 클릭합시다.


그럼 채팅창에 다음과 같이 방금 클릭한 토큰의 ID가 뜹니다. 복사해서 매크로에 마저 입력해줍시다.



마지막으로 플레이어가 해당 매크로를 쓸 수 있게 하려면 다음의 명령어를 입력해줘야할 필요가 있습니다.

이것을 사용하지않으면 플레이어가 매크로를 사용할 수 없습니다.

!token-mod --config players-can-ids|on

위의 명령어를 채팅창에 입력해주면 다음과 같은 화면이 나옵니다. 여기까지 했다면 끝입니다.



4. 응용

3-2의 내용과 이전에 배포했던 맵 조사형 매크로를 함께 사용하면 아래처럼 클릭한 장소로 이동하는 것도 가능합니다.



자세한 부분은 맵 조사형 매크로를 참고해주시고 원하는 영역(bar1이나 token_name등등)에 아래의 명령어를 넣어두면 됩니다.

!token-mod --ids token의 ID --set currentside|원하는 배경에 해당하는 숫자

설명이 부족한 듯 싶어서 참고용으로 제가 실제로 사용했던 매크로 스크린샷을 첨부해둡니다.



하다가 막히는 부분이 있으시면 @kra_trpg로 질문주세요.

+ Recent posts